About this listen

At just twenty years old, Vincent was forced into the leadership role in one of the most ruthless crime families in Florida after the brutal murder of his father and sister.

Hardened by grief, Vincent became cold and calculated, living only to expand his empire and protect the only family he had left. Love was nonexistent in a life like his.

Then came Anila. She is the opposite of everything Vincent knows. An equestrian with a heart of gold and dreams of making an impact in her community. She's no stranger to sacrifice, and falling for Vincent's dangerously magnetic charm is the last risk she can afford to take.

Vincent isn't used to hearing the word no, and Anila isn't used to being pursued with such intensity. Their connection is undeniable, and their passion unstoppable, but a glimpse into Vincent's unhinged antics forces Anila to run away.

In this African American Urban Romance standalone, boundaries are pushed past their limits, and the stakes rise higher than ever. Can Anila truly love a man whose empire is built on blood? Or will loving the mafia menace be one of the best decisions in her life?
